#c084c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c084c2 is composed of 75.3% red, 51.8%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1% cyan, 32%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 298.1 degrees, a saturation of 33.7% and a lightness of 63.9%. #c084c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#810985.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

● #c084c2 color description : Slightly desaturated magenta.
#c084c2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c084c2 has RGB values of R:192, G:132,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0.32,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12616898.

Shades and Tints of #c084c2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080408 is the darkest color, while #fcfaf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#c084c2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a6a0a6 is the less saturated color, while #f54bfb is the most saturated one.
